Broward County permits accessory dwelling units in several zoning districts, typically capped at 800 square feet or 40 percent of the primary home, with owner-occupancy and one off-street parking space.
Florida Senate Bill 184 (2025) β Housing (creates Fla. Stat. Β§ 163.31771, Accessory dwelling units)
Housing; Authorizing a landlord to accept reusable tenant screening reports and require a specified statement; requiring, rather than authorizing, local governments to adopt, by a specified date, an ordinance to allow accessory dwelling units in certain areas; authorizing a local government to provide a density bonus incentive to landowners who make certain real property donations to assist in ...
Sheds and accessory buildings in unincorporated Broward County must comply with Ch. 39 zoning setbacks and the Florida Building Code with HVHZ enhancements. An accessory building must be subordinate to the principal use per Β§39-4. Building permits are required.
Broward requires a building permit for every garage conversion and mandates replacement off-street parking plus HVHZ-rated windows, doors, and insulation.
Carports in unincorporated Broward County (the BMSD) need a Broward County building permit and must satisfy Chapter 39 (Zoning) setbacks. Because Broward sits in the Florida Building Code's High-Velocity Hurricane Zone, carports must meet HVHZ wind loads.
Florida adopted IRC Appendix Q in the Florida Building Code, Residential, 8th Ed. (2023): a tiny house is 400 sq ft or less. In the BMSD, a tiny house must still satisfy Chapter 39 zoning, sit on a permitted foundation, and meet HVHZ wind loads.
